Official Form 101: captures debtor identity, chapter selection, relief sought, and jurisdictional statements required at filing.
Schedules A/B, C, D, E/F: itemize assets, exemptions, secured and unsecured claims, and priority creditor details for trustee review.
Official Statement of Financial Affairs: documents prepetition transactions, income, transfers, and litigation history relevant to estate administration.
Form 122A-1/122C-1 where applicable: calculates current monthly income and disposable income to determine chapter eligibility or plan requirements.
District-specific checklists and local rule confirmations to address variations in filing format, required exhibits, and fee handling.
Pay stubs, tax returns, bank statements, and creditor lists formatted for attachment and quick reference by trustees and the clerk.
